@charset "utf-8";
@-moz-keyframes loading_rotate{from{transform:rotate(0)}to{transform:rotate(360deg)}}@-webkit-keyframes loading_rotate{from{transform:rotate(0)}to{transform:rotate(360deg)}}@-o-keyframes loading_rotate{from{transform:rotate(0)}to{transform:rotate(360deg)}}@keyframes loading_rotate{from{transform:rotate(0)}to{transform:rotate(360deg)}}.c-information{margin-top:2rem;border-top:1px dashed #999}.c-information__group{display:flex;border-bottom:1px dashed #999;font-size:.8125rem}.c-information__title,.c-information__text{padding:8px 0}.c-information__title{flex:0 0 100px}.c-selectOrder{margin-top:16px}.c-selectOrder__title{padding:8px;border-bottom:1px dotted #ccc}.c-selectOrder__body{padding:16px 8px}.c-selectOrder__clear{margin:16px 0 8px;text-align:right}.c-inputType{margin-top:16px}.c-inputType__box{border-top:none}.c-inputType__flex{display:flex}.c-inputType__flexLeft,.c-inputType__flexRight{width:50%;max-width:528px;}.c-inputType__flexLeft .c-inputType__input,.c-inputType__flexRight .c-inputType__input{margin-top:8px;}.c-inputType__flexLeft .c-inputType__input .m-inputText,.c-inputType__flexRight .c-inputType__input .m-inputText{box-sizing:border-box;width:100%}.c-inputType__flexRight{margin-left:40px}.c-inputType__clear{text-align:right}.c-inputType__suggestBoxWrap{position:relative}.c-inputType__suggestBox{width:100%;position:absolute;top:0;left:0;z-index:1;font-size:0}.c-inputType__suggestBox__main{box-sizing:border-box;display:inline-block;width:100%;position:relative;border:1px solid #ccc;border-top:none;background:#fff;box-shadow:0 0 8px rgba(0,0,0,0.2);vertical-align:top;word-wrap:break-word;font-size:.9375rem}.c-inputType__suggestBox__list{padding:3px 0 5px 0}.c-inputType__suggestBox__link{display:block;padding:2px 10px;text-decoration:none;}.c-inputType__suggestBox__link:hover,.c-inputType__suggestBox__link.is-focus{background-color:#ecf3fc;color:#004098;text-decoration:underline}.c-resultHeader.is-fixed{position:fixed;top:0;left:0;z-index:1;box-sizing:border-box;width:100%;padding:0 10px;background:#fff}.c-resultHeader.is-absolute{position:absolute;left:0;z-index:1;box-sizing:border-box;width:100%;padding:0 10px;background:#fff}.c-chemicaldbTableHeadWrap,.c-chemicaldbTableBodyWrap{display:flex;}.c-chemicaldbTableHeadWrap--left,.c-chemicaldbTableBodyWrap--left{width:721px}.c-chemicaldbTableHeadWrap--right,.c-chemicaldbTableBodyWrap--right{width:calc(100% - 721px);overflow:hidden}.c-chemicaldbTableHeadWrap.is-fixed{position:fixed;top:0;left:0;z-index:2;box-sizing:border-box;width:100%;min-width:950px;padding:0 10px}.c-chemicaldbTableHeadWrap.is-absolute{position:absolute;left:0;z-index:2;box-sizing:border-box;width:100%;min-width:950px;padding:0 10px}.c-chemicaldbTable{min-width:100%;table-layout:fixed;border-collapse:collapse;}.c-chemicaldbTable > thead > tr{vertical-align:middle;}.c-chemicaldbTable > thead > tr.cc-bottom{vertical-align:bottom}.c-chemicaldbTable > thead > tr > th{box-sizing:border-box;padding:5px;border:1px solid #ccc;text-align:center;font-size:.8125rem;font-weight:normal;background-color:#ddd;}.c-chemicaldbTable > thead > tr > th .cc-text--rl{width:300px;margin-top:5px;margin-left:-122px;transform:rotate(90deg);transform-origin:50% 50%;text-align:left}.c-chemicaldbTable > tbody > tr > th{box-sizing:border-box;padding:5px;border:1px solid #ccc;text-align:center;font-size:.8125rem;font-weight:normal;background-color:#ddd}.c-chemicaldbTable > tbody > tr > td{box-sizing:border-box;padding:5px;border:1px solid #ccc;border-top:none;text-align:center;font-size:.8125rem;font-weight:normal;}.c-chemicaldbTable > tbody > tr > td > a{text-decoration:none;}.c-chemicaldbTable > tbody > tr > td > a:hover{text-decoration:underline}.c-chemicaldbTable > tbody > tr.cc-none > td{background-color:#f5f5f5}.c-chemicaldbTable.is-headerLeft{width:100%;}.c-chemicaldbTable.is-headerLeft > thead > tr > th{height:88px}.c-chemicaldbTable.is-headerRight{width:1px;min-width:auto;}.c-chemicaldbTable.is-headerRight > thead > tr > th{width:65px;border-left:none;font-weight:bold;overflow:hidden}.c-chemicaldbTable.is-bodyLeft{width:100%;}.c-chemicaldbTable.is-bodyLeft > tbody > tr > td.cc-product{text-align:left}.c-chemicaldbTable.is-bodyLeft > tbody > tr > td .cc-checkbox{display:inline-block;width:16px;height:16px;background:url("data:image/svg+xml;base64,PHN2ZyB3aWR0aD0iMTYiIGhlaWdodD0iMTYiIHZpZXdCb3g9IjAgMCAxNiAxNiIgZmlsbD0ibm9uZSIgeG1sbnM9Imh0dHA6Ly93d3cudzMub3JnLzIwMDAvc3ZnIj4KPHJlY3QgeD0iMC41IiB5PSIwLjUiIHdpZHRoPSIxNSIgaGVpZ2h0PSIxNSIgcng9IjEuNSIgZmlsbD0id2hpdGUiIHN0cm9rZT0iIzk5OTk5OSIvPgo8L3N2Zz4K") no-repeat center center;cursor:pointer;}.c-chemicaldbTable.is-bodyLeft > tbody > tr > td .cc-checkbox.on{background-image:url("data:image/svg+xml;base64,PHN2ZyB3aWR0aD0iMTYiIGhlaWdodD0iMTYiIHZpZXdCb3g9IjAgMCAxNiAxNiIgZmlsbD0ibm9uZSIgeG1sbnM9Imh0dHA6Ly93d3cudzMub3JnLzIwMDAvc3ZnIj4KPHJlY3Qgd2lkdGg9IjE2IiBoZWlnaHQ9IjE2IiByeD0iMiIgZmlsbD0iIzAwNDA5OCIvPgo8ZyBjbGlwLXBhdGg9InVybCgjY2xpcDBfMTIwOV83NjI3KSI+CjxwYXRoIGQ9Ik02LjcxIDEyLjEyTDMgOC40MUw0LjQxIDdMNi43MSA5LjI5TDEyIDRMMTMuNDEgNS40MUw2LjcxIDEyLjEyWiIgZmlsbD0id2hpdGUiLz4KPC9nPgo8ZGVmcz4KPGNsaXBQYXRoIGlkPSJjbGlwMF8xMjA5Xzc2MjciPgo8cmVjdCB3aWR0aD0iMTAuNDEiIGhlaWdodD0iOC4xMiIgZmlsbD0id2hpdGUiIHRyYW5zZm9ybT0idHJhbnNsYXRlKDMgNCkiLz4KPC9jbGlwUGF0aD4KPC9kZWZzPgo8L3N2Zz4K")}.c-chemicaldbTable.is-bodyLeft > tbody > tr > td > a{font-weight:bold}.c-chemicaldbTable.is-bodyRight{width:1px;min-width:auto;}.c-chemicaldbTable.is-bodyRight > tbody > tr > td{width:65px;border-left:none}.c-chemicaldbTable.is-left{width:1px;}.c-chemicaldbTable.is-left > thead > tr > th{width:72px;height:320px}.c-chemicaldbTable.is-right{width:1px;min-width:auto;}.c-chemicaldbTable.is-right > thead > tr > th{width:65px;height:320px;font-weight:bold}.c-productInfo{margin:20px 20px 0}.c-h2--productInfo{font-size:.9375rem;font-weight:bold}.c-chemicaldbTableWrap{display:flex;}.c-chemicaldbTableWrap--left{position:relative;z-index:1;width:72px}.c-chemicaldbTableWrap--right{width:calc(100% - 72px);overflow:hidden}.c-inputArea{display:flex;flex-wrap:wrap;align-items:baseline;margin-top:16px;}.c-inputArea > dt{flex-basis:100px;margin:4px 0}.c-inputArea > dd{flex-basis:calc(100% - 100px);margin:4px 0;}.c-inputArea > dd .m-alert{margin-top:4px}.c-inputArea > dd .m-inputText[size]{max-width:358px;box-sizing:border-box}.c-datepicker{width:85px;padding:6px 10px 6px 29px;background-image:url("data:image/svg+xml;base64,PHN2ZyB3aWR0aD0iMTYiIGhlaWdodD0iMTYiIHZpZXdCb3g9IjAgMCAxNiAxNiIgZmlsbD0ibm9uZSIgeG1sbnM9Imh0dHA6Ly93d3cudzMub3JnLzIwMDAvc3ZnIj4KPHBhdGggZD0iTTAuNzUgMTUuMjVWMi43NUgxNS4yNVYxNS4yNUgwLjc1WiIgc3Ryb2tlPSIjMDA0MDk4IiBzdHJva2Utd2lkdGg9IjEuNSIvPgo8cGF0aCBkPSJNMSA2TDE1IDYiIHN0cm9rZT0iIzAwNDA5OCIgc3Ryb2tlLXdpZHRoPSIxLjUiLz4KPHBhdGggZD0iTTQgOUwxMiA5IiBzdHJva2U9IiMwMDQwOTgiIHN0cm9rZS13aWR0aD0iMS41Ii8+CjxwYXRoIGQ9Ik00IDEyTDEyIDEyIiBzdHJva2U9IiMwMDQwOTgiIHN0cm9rZS13aWR0aD0iMS41Ii8+CjxwYXRoIGQ9Ik00IDBMNCA2IiBzdHJva2U9IiMwMDQwOTgiIHN0cm9rZS13aWR0aD0iMS41Ii8+CjxwYXRoIGQ9Ik0xMiAwTDEyIDYiIHN0cm9rZT0iIzAwNDA5OCIgc3Ryb2tlLXdpZHRoPSIxLjUiLz4KPC9zdmc+Cg==");background-position:5px center;background-repeat:no-repeat}.c-btnListWrap{margin-top:40px;}.c-btnListWrap + .m-h2{margin-top:-20px}